ZOO Project WPS implementation testing

ZOO-PSC would like to report results of tests conducted on ZOO-Kernel WPS implementation. Comparison of some current WPS implementation was reported in presentation entitled "COMPLIANCE TESTING OF OPEN SOURCE SOFTWARE FOR WEB PROCESSING SERVICES" link.

Our testing results are presented in more details below. The test with ZOO WPS are contrary to the presentation mentioned above link. We call upon the authors of the presentation referred above to make appropriate corrections in their presentation in light of our test results outlined below. We hope that a more well planned and coordinated implementation testing can be done in the future.

Gérald Fenoy (Chair ZOO PSC)

ZOO Project WPS testing details

In the FOSS4G2010 presentation link, some unusual behavior of the ZOO Kernel was pointed out. Hence, the ZOO PSC decided to conduct our own tests with ZOO WPS implementation using the same method reported in the FOSS4G2010 presentation.

First note about this response that we have prepared, we weren't able to use XMLSpy 2007 Professional version as no more Evaluation version is available, so we used the XMLSpy 2011 Professional one as we can use it for an evaluation period of 30 days.

All the following requests give documents which are valid (using XMLSpy 2011 Professional) against the used schemas.

GetCapabilities request

In the FOSS4G2010 presentation link, an error was pointed out about some unexpected metadata : namely Test attribute to the Metadata node getting the "Demo" value. This was due to wrong ZCFG files of the first Services we made in the beginning of the 2009 year.

The provided URL to run this test is wrong, one would use this one :

http://zoo-project.org/cgi-bin-new/zoo_loader.cgi?REQUEST=GetCapabilities&SERVICE=WPS&version=1.0.0

So, for the GetCapabilities request, the Capabilities document output by the ZOO Kernel is Valid.

DescribeProcess request

It was also reported in the presentation that ZOO Kernel can't handle the DescribeProcess request and output a valid ProcessDescriptions Document. Indeed the first versions of ZOO Kernel was wrong in that, but hopefully the last one, included in OSGeoLiveDVD 4.0 returns already the valid ProcessDescriptions document.

http://zoo-project.org/cgi-bin-new/zoo_loader.cgi?REQUEST=DescribeProcess&SERVICE=WPS&version=1.0.0&Identifier=Buffer

Using the url above we can confirm that ZOO Kernel provide Valid response for the DescribeProcess request.

Note that this request is Valid also :

http://zoo-project.org/cgi-bin-new/zoo_loader.cgi?REQUEST=DescribeProcess&SERVICE=WPS&version=1.0.0&Identifier=Buffer,Boundary,Centroid,ConvexHull,Simplify,Union,Intersection,Difference,SymDifference

Execute request

ZOO WPS provides valid response for Execute as XML POST requests, as it is the mandatory method.

To use the XML POST requests, please copy/paste from this page, please follow this link to paste in the HTML form.

Synchronous call using asReference

<wps:Execute service="WPS" version="1.0.0" xmlns:wps="http://www.opengis.net/wps/1.0.0" xmlns:ows="http://www.opengis.net/ows/1.1"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ance" xsi:schemaLocation="http://www.opengis.net/wps/1.0.0 http://schemas.opengis.net/wps/1.0.0/wpsExecute_request.xsd">
<ows:Identifier>Buffer</ows:Identifier>
<wps:DataInputs>
<wps:Input>
<ows:Identifier>InputPolygon</ows:Identifier>
<ows:Title>Playground area</ows:Title>
<wps:Reference xlink:href="http://dreal-official.geolabs.fr/mapjax/webservices/wfs/dreal_lr_general/?VERSION=1.1.0&amp;version=1.0.0&amp;request=GetFeature&amp;typename=Znieff1&amp;maxfeatures=1"/></wps:Input>
<wps:Input>
<ows:Identifier>BufferDistance</ows:Identifier>
<ows:Title>Distance which people will walk to get to a playground.</ows:Title>
<wps:Data>
<wps:LiteralData>10</wps:LiteralData>
</wps:Data>
</wps:Input>
</wps:DataInputs>
<wps:ResponseForm>
<wps:ResponseDocument storeExecuteResponse="false">
<wps:Output asReference="true">
<ows:Identifier>Result</ows:Identifier>
</wps:Output>
</wps:ResponseDocument>
</wps:ResponseForm>
</wps:Execute>
